I use Upstraps - I like how they stay on your shoulder - your shirt is more likely to get pulled off by the weight of the camera than the rubber pad sliding off. But when I carry the camera in the hand and wrap the strap around my wrist it's not so comfortable - the strap is a stiff nylon that can chafe the skin, while the rubber pad is very stiff (more so the SLR strap than the RF strap).

I prefer the Voigtlander cloth strap if I'm going to be walking around with the camera in hand and strap wrapped around my wrist.

And for heavy cameras hung from the neck, I prefer a neoprene strap.
